就是我现在做了一个离线APP,在有网络的时候将需要的数据先加载进去,需要的时候调用即可,但是我现在的问题就是,到了没网络的地方,有一个表单录数据并且现场拍照,待有网络的时候再将数据和照片提交,数据保存没问题,就是照片的离线存储是怎么做的,求大神赐教。
人来丶狗往
- 发布:2016-09-09 10:51
- 更新:2016-09-11 16:24
- 阅读:1901
3 个回复
赵梦欢 - 专注前端,乐于分享!
拍完照片将图片放在一个固定的文件夹下,将图片路径存放在storage中,监听网络事件,然后查询存储的值,若有值就上传,上传成功后清除,否则就不执行。
1***@qq.com
可以将图片转成base64,需要的时候在解码保存文件-->上传
Trust - 少说废话
请参考App离线本地存储方案。照片资源,拍照后会保存在当前应用的目录下,只需要存储相应的正确的路径,即可读取正确的文件。